Harriman, TN, UB made a bit of history April 2, when its board of directors hired Candace Vannasdale to succeed the retiring Bill Young as general manager.

Vannasdale, who’s tentatively scheduled to start May 1, would be the first female general manager at Harriman UB. She’s served for the past four years as manager of the utility’s gas/water/sewer administration and engineering.

A native of McMinnville, TN, Vannasdale earned her undergraduate degree in civil engineering from Tennessee Tech University and her graduate degree in environmental engineering from the University of Tennessee.

She serves as Harriman UB’s designated member for the Tennessee Association of Utility Districts (TAUD), Tennessee Gas Association (TGA), American Public Gas Association (APGA), and Natural Gas Distributor’s Association of East Tennessee (NGDAET), and American Water Works Association (AWWA).
